It¡¡is¡¡imaginable¡¡of¡¡Harte¡¡that¡¡this¡¡temperament¡¡defended¡¡him¡¡from¡¡any
bitterness¡¡in¡¡the¡¡disappointment¡¡he¡¡may¡¡have¡¡shared¡¡with¡¡that¡¡simple
American¡¡public¡¡which¡¡in¡¡the¡¡early¡¡eighteen¡­seventies¡¡expected¡¡any¡¡and
everything¡¡of¡¡him¡¡in¡¡fiction¡¡and¡¡drama¡£¡¡¡¡The¡¡long¡¡breath¡¡was¡¡not¡¡his£»¡¡he
could¡¡not¡¡write¡¡a¡¡novel£»¡¡though¡¡he¡¡produced¡¡the¡¡like¡¡of¡¡one¡¡or¡¡two£»¡¡and
his¡¡plays¡¡were¡¡too¡¡bad¡¡for¡¡the¡¡stage£»¡¡or¡¡else¡¡too¡¡good¡¡for¡¡it¡£¡¡¡¡At¡¡any
rate£»¡¡they¡¡could¡¡not¡¡keep¡¡it£»¡¡even¡¡when¡¡they¡¡got¡¡it£»¡¡and¡¡they¡¡denoted¡¡the
fatigue¡¡or¡¡the¡¡indifference¡¡of¡¡their¡¡author¡¡in¡¡being¡¡dramatizations¡¡of
his¡¡longer¡¡or¡¡shorter¡¡fictions£»¡¡and¡¡not¡¡originally¡¡dramatic¡¡efforts¡£
The¡¡direction¡¡in¡¡which¡¡his¡¡originality¡¡lasted¡¡longest£»¡¡and¡¡most
strikingly¡¡affirmed¡¡his¡¡power£»¡¡was¡¡in¡¡the¡¡direction¡¡of¡¡his¡¡verse¡£

Whatever¡¡minds¡¡there¡¡may¡¡be¡¡about¡¡Harte's¡¡fiction¡¡finally£»¡¡there¡¡can
hardly¡¡be¡¡more¡¡than¡¡one¡¡mind¡¡about¡¡his¡¡poetry¡£¡¡¡¡He¡¡was¡¡indeed¡¡a¡¡poet£»
whether¡¡he¡¡wrote¡¡what¡¡drolly¡¡called¡¡itself¡¡¡¨dialect£»¡¨¡¡or¡¡wrote¡¡language£»
he¡¡was¡¡a¡¡poet¡¡of¡¡a¡¡fine¡¡and¡¡fresh¡¡touch¡£¡¡¡¡It¡¡must¡¡be¡¡allowed¡¡him¡¡that¡¡in
prose¡¡as¡¡well¡¡he¡¡had¡¡the¡¡inventive¡¡gift£»¡¡but¡¡he¡¡had¡¡it¡¡in¡¡verse¡¡far¡¡more
importantly¡£¡¡¡¡There¡¡are¡¡lines£»¡¡phrases£»¡¡turns¡¡in¡¡his¡¡poems£»
characterizations£»¡¡and¡¡pictures¡¡which¡¡will¡¡remain¡¡as¡¡enduringly¡¡as
anything¡¡American£»¡¡if¡¡that¡¡is¡¡not¡¡saying¡¡altogether¡¡too¡¡little¡¡for¡¡them¡£
In¡¡poetry¡¡he¡¡rose¡¡to¡¡all¡¡the¡¡occasions¡¡he¡¡made¡¡for¡¡himself£»¡¡though¡¡he
could¡¡not¡¡rise¡¡to¡¡the¡¡occasions¡¡made¡¡for¡¡him£»¡¡and¡¡so¡¡far¡¡failed¡¡in¡¡the
demands¡¡he¡¡acceded¡¡to¡¡for¡¡a¡¡Phi¡¡Beta¡¡Kappa¡¡poem£»¡¡as¡¡to¡¡come¡¡to¡¡that
august¡¡Harvard¡¡occasion¡¡with¡¡a¡¡jingle¡¡so¡¡trivial£»¡¡so¡¡out¡¡of¡¡keeping£»¡¡so
inadequate¡¡that¡¡his¡¡enemies£»¡¡if¡¡he¡¡ever¡¡truly¡¡had¡¡any£»¡¡must¡¡have¡¡suffered
from¡¡it¡¡almost¡¡as¡¡much¡¡as¡¡his¡¡friends¡£¡¡¡¡He¡¡himself¡¡did¡¡not¡¡suffer¡¡from
his¡¡failure£»¡¡from¡¡having¡¡read¡¡before¡¡the¡¡most¡¡elect¡¡assembly¡¡of¡¡the
country¡¡a¡¡poem¡¡which¡¡would¡¡hardly¡¡have¡¡served¡¡the¡¡careless¡¡needs¡¡of¡¡an
informal¡¡dinner¡¡after¡¡the¡¡speaking¡¡had¡¡begun£»¡¡he¡¡took¡¡the¡¡whole
disastrous¡¡business¡¡lightly£»¡¡gayly£»¡¡leniently£»¡¡kindly£»¡¡as¡¡that¡¡golden
temperament¡¡of¡¡his¡¡enabled¡¡him¡¡to¡¡take¡¡all¡¡the¡¡good¡¡or¡¡bad¡¡of¡¡life¡£

The¡¡first¡¡year¡¡of¡¡his¡¡Eastern¡¡sojourn¡¡was¡¡salaried¡¡in¡¡a¡¡sum¡¡which¡¡took
the¡¡souls¡¡of¡¡all¡¡his¡¡young¡¡contemporaries¡¡with¡¡wonder£»¡¡if¡¡no¡¡baser
passion£»¡¡in¡¡the¡¡days¡¡when¡¡dollars¡¡were¡¡of¡¡so¡¡much¡¡farther¡¡flight¡¡than
now£»¡¡but¡¡its¡¡net¡¡result¡¡in¡¡a¡¡literary¡¡return¡¡to¡¡his¡¡publishers¡¡was¡¡one
story¡¡and¡¡two¡¡or¡¡three¡¡poems¡£¡¡¡¡They¡¡had¡¡not¡¡profited¡¡much¡¡by¡¡his¡¡book£»
which£»¡¡it¡¡will¡¡doubtless¡¡amaze¡¡a¡¡time¡¡of¡¡fifty¡¡thousand¡¡editions¡¡selling
before¡¡their¡¡publication£»¡¡to¡¡learn¡¡had¡¡sold¡¡only¡¡thirty¡­five¡¡hundred¡¡in
the¡¡sixth¡¡month¡¡of¡¡its¡¡career£»¡¡as¡¡Harte¡¡himself£»

¡¡¡¡¡¡¡¡¡¡¡¡¡¡¡¡¡¡¡¡¡¨With¡¡sick¡¡and¡¡scornful¡¡looks¡¡averse£»¡¨

confided¡¡to¡¡his¡¡Cambridge¡¡host¡¡after¡¡his¡¡first¡¡interview¡¡with¡¡the¡¡Boston
counting¡­room¡£¡¡¡¡It¡¡was¡¡the¡¡volume¡¡which¡¡contained¡¡¡¨The¡¡Luck¡¡of¡¡Roaring
Camp£»¡¨¡¡and¡¡the¡¡other¡¡early¡¡tales¡¡which¡¡made¡¡him¡¡a¡¡continental£»¡¡and¡¡then
an¡¡all¡¡but¡¡a¡¡world¡­wide¡¡fame¡£¡¡¡¡Stories¡¡that¡¡had¡¡been¡¡talked¡¡over£»¡¡and
laughed¡¡over£»¡¡and¡¡cried¡¡over¡¡all¡¡up¡¡and¡¡down¡¡the¡¡land£»¡¡that¡¡had¡¡been
received¡¡with¡¡acclaim¡¡by¡¡criticism¡¡almost¡¡as¡¡boisterous¡¡as¡¡their
popularity£»¡¡and¡¡recognized¡¡as¡¡the¡¡promise¡¡of¡¡greater¡¡things¡¡than¡¡any¡¡done
before¡¡in¡¡their¡¡kind£»¡¡came¡¡to¡¡no¡¡more¡¡than¡¡this¡¡pitiful¡¡figure¡¡over¡¡the
booksellers'¡¡counters¡£¡¡¡¡It¡¡argued¡¡much¡¡for¡¡the¡¡publishers¡¡that¡¡in¡¡spite
of¡¡this¡¡stupefying¡¡result¡¡they¡¡were¡¡willing£»¡¡they¡¡were¡¡eager£»¡¡to¡¡pay¡¡him
ten¡¡thousand¡¡dollars¡¡for¡¡whatever£»¡¡however¡¡much¡¡or¡¡little£»¡¡he¡¡chose¡¡to
write¡¡in¡¡a¡¡year£º¡¡Their¡¡offer¡¡was¡¡made¡¡in¡¡Boston£»¡¡after¡¡some¡¡offers
mortifyingly¡¡mean£»¡¡and¡¡others¡¡insultingly¡¡vague£»¡¡had¡¡been¡¡made¡¡in¡¡New
York¡£

It¡¡is¡¡useless¡¡to¡¡wonder¡¡now¡¡what¡¡would¡¡have¡¡been¡¡his¡¡future¡¡if¡¡the
publisher¡¡of¡¡the¡¡Overland¡¡Monthly¡¡had¡¡been¡¡of¡¡imagination¡¡or¡¡capital
enough¡¡to¡¡meet¡¡the¡¡demand¡¡which¡¡Harte¡¡dimly¡¡intimated¡¡to¡¡his¡¡Cambridge
host¡¡as¡¡the¡¡condition¡¡of¡¡his¡¡remaining¡¡in¡¡California¡£¡¡¡¡Publishers£»¡¡men
with¡¡sufficient¡¡capital£»¡¡are¡¡of¡¡a¡¡greatly¡¡varying¡¡gift¡¡in¡¡the¡¡regions¡¡of
prophecy£»¡¡and¡¡he¡¡of¡¡the¡¡Overland¡¡Monthly¡¡was¡¡not¡¡to¡¡be¡¡blamed¡¡if¡¡he¡¡could
not¡¡foresee¡¡his¡¡account¡¡in¡¡paying¡¡Harte¡¡ten¡¡thousand¡¡a¡¡year¡¡to¡¡continue
editing¡¡the¡¡magazine¡£¡¡¡¡He¡¡did¡¡according¡¡to¡¡his¡¡lights£»¡¡and¡¡Harte¡¡came¡¡to
the¡¡East£»¡¡and¡¡then¡¡went¡¡to¡¡England£»¡¡where¡¡his¡¡last¡¡twenty¡­five¡¡years¡¡were
passed¡¡in¡¡cultivating¡¡the¡¡wild¡¡plant¡¡of¡¡his¡¡Pacific¡¡Slope¡¡discovery¡£¡¡¡¡It
was¡¡always¡¡the¡¡same¡¡plant£»¡¡leaf¡¡and¡¡flower¡¡and¡¡fruit£»¡¡but¡¡it¡¡perennially
pleased¡¡the¡¡constant¡¡English¡¡world£»¡¡and¡¡thence¡¡the¡¡European¡¡world£»¡¡though
it¡¡presently¡¡failed¡¡of¡¡much¡¡delighting¡¡these¡¡fastidious¡¡States¡£¡¡¡¡Probably
he¡¡would¡¡have¡¡done¡¡something¡¡else¡¡if¡¡he¡¡could£»¡¡he¡¡did¡¡not¡¡keep¡¡on¡¡doing
the¡¡wild¡¡mining¡­camp¡¡thing¡¡because¡¡it¡¡was¡¡the¡¡easiest£»¡¡but¡¡because¡¡it¡¡was
for¡¡him¡¡the¡¡only¡¡possible¡¡thing¡£¡¡¡¡Very¡¡likely¡¡he¡¡might¡¡have¡¡preferred¡¡not
doing¡¡anything¡£
